Exploring Your Generator: Types and Functions
Generators serve as critical power sources in various situations, spanning residential use to industrial applications. They fall broadly into two categories: portable and standby types. Portable generators tend to be smaller units built for temporary use, making them a great choice for camping, tailgating, or serving as emergency backup during outages. These generators provide convenience and flexibility, enabling users to transport them with ease whenever necessary.
Standby generators, by comparison, are fixed installations that automatically engage whenever a power failure occurs. They are typically integrated into the home's electrical system, offering a smooth transition to backup power. Among these categories, generators have the ability to function on a range of fuel sources, including gasoline, diesel, propane, or natural gas, each presenting its own unique pros and cons.
Grasping the diverse types and functions of electrical generators is crucial for identifying the correct devices for unique applications, providing reliability and efficiency in power generation.
Recognizing Typical Generator Problems
Diagnosing generator issues promptly source can prevent further complications and secure reliable performance. Common generator problems often manifest as unusual noises, failure to start, or inconsistent power output. A generator experiencing starting difficulties might suggest a depleted battery, fuel complications, or a malfunctioning ignition system. Abnormal sounds like grinding or rattling might point to mechanical degradation or loose elements, necessitating urgent assessment.
Electrical surges frequently indicate problems with the power regulator or other electrical components, affecting overall efficiency. Additionally, generators might release smoke or strong odors, hinting at fuel leaks or overheating, which necessitate prompt intervention. Regularly checking fuel levels, oil quality, and air filters can assist in recognizing these issues early. By understanding these frequent indicators, equipment operators can adopt forward-thinking strategies to ensure their devices continue to perform reliably, ultimately increasing its longevity and consistent performance.

Scheduled Oil Changes
One of the most essential aspects of generator maintenance is the practice of regular oil changes. This practice ensures that the engine performs smoothly and reliably by minimizing friction and avoiding wear. Over time, oil can be compromised by debris, metallic particles, and combustion residue, causing diminished performance and potential harm. It is generally recommended to replace the oil after each 100-hour operational period or a minimum of once per year, depending on which milestone is reached first. Selecting the appropriate type and grade of oil, as specified by the manufacturer, is critical for peak performance. Overlooking this maintenance requirement can cause overheating, elevated fuel usage, and ultimately, generator breakdown. Routine oil changes play a key role in prolonging the generator's lifespan.
Clean Air Filters
Maintaining clean air filters is crucial for the ideal performance and longevity of a generator. Air filters act as a barrier against dust and debris reaching the engine, which can cause inefficient combustion and potential damage. Consistent inspection and maintenance of air filters are critical, particularly in dusty environments. It is advisable to examine filters every few months and change them out if they exhibit signs of deterioration or significant debris buildup. A clean air filter improves airflow, boosting fuel efficiency and minimizing engine stress. This straightforward upkeep task can significantly prolong the generator's lifespan, guaranteeing it runs reliably whenever required. By focusing on keeping air filters clean, individuals can preserve their investment in generator efficiency and dependability.
Step-by-Step Diagnostic Methods
Troubleshooting a generator demands a structured approach to identify and resolve issues effectively. Begin by checking the fuel supply. If the generator does not start, verify the fuel tank is adequately filled and the fuel is clean and fresh. Following that, inspect the oil level; a lack of oil can initiate automatic shutdowns. After that, examine the battery connections for deterioration or poor connections. If the generator functions but delivers no output, inspecting the circuit breaker and fuses becomes critical.
Moreover, examine the spark plug for deterioration or damage, as a worn spark plug can impede the ignition process. If the unit generates unusual noises, this may indicate internal problems that warrant additional investigation. To conclude, referencing the product manual for targeted troubleshooting advice can provide tailored solutions. By implementing these steps, you can thoroughly pinpoint and correct common generator problems, guaranteeing optimal performance whenever needed.
Follow Safety Precautions for Generator Repairs
When fixing a generator, observing safety precautions is critical to avoid accidents and injuries. To begin, confirm that the generator is switched off and unplugged from any power supply. This helps prevent the risk of electric shock. Wearing personal protective equipment, including gloves and safety glasses, can provide additional protection against potential hazards. Working in a well-ventilated area is strongly encouraged to avoid inhaling harmful fumes from fuel or exhaust.
In addition, having a fire extinguisher within reach is essential, as generators can create fire hazards. Maintenance workers should also be mindful when dealing with fuel, making sure that spills are cleaned promptly to avoid slip and fire risks. Lastly, having a first aid kit on hand can be valuable in case of small injuries. By following these safety measures, workers can create a safer environment while performing generator repairs, protecting both personnel and the machinery.
When Is It Time to Call a Professional for Generator Repairs?
Generator repairs can often be managed by knowledgeable individuals, but particular scenarios call for the knowledge of a qualified expert. Should a generator refuse to start after initial troubleshooting attempts, it may indicate deeper issues that require specialized knowledge. Additionally, ongoing strange sounds or vibrations may indicate mechanical issues that could deteriorate without professional attention.
Electrical issues, such as blown fuses or damaged wiring, pose serious safety risks and should be addressed by a qualified technician. If the generator is leaking fuel or oil, urgent professional intervention is required to eliminate the threat of fire dangers. Additionally, if the generator is currently within its warranty period, conducting DIY fixes might nullify your coverage, making certified service the wiser option. Understanding these circumstances confirms the generator performs optimally and safely, maintaining its durability and performance.
Preparing Your Generator for Seasonal Changes
With changing seasons, preparing a generator for different weather conditions is vital to maintain top performance. Scheduled maintenance should be arranged prior to seasonal changes, concentrating on tasks appropriate for the approaching climate. In preparation for winter, verifying adequate fuel stabilization and battery condition is essential, as colder temperatures can affect performance. Moreover, examining the oil levels and swapping filters assists in reducing complications during demanding usage.
In contrast, seasonal summer maintenance entails inspecting cooling systems, as high temperatures may cause overheating. Maintaining air filters and checking ventilation pathways are critical for proper airflow.
Year-round, it's important to conduct regular load tests on the generator to verify functionality. Doing so not only identifies potential problems but also assures reliability when needed. Additionally, protecting the generator from harsh weather conditions, such as rain or snow, by installing suitable protective covers or enclosures can significantly prolong its service life and preserve optimal performance.

How Often Should I Run My Generator for Maintenance?
Generators need to be started at least once a month as part of routine maintenance. Routine running helps preserving fuel quality, ensures internal parts remain lubricated, and detects possible problems, ensuring reliable performance when needed, thereby prolonging the generator's lifespan.
Am I Able to Use My Generator Inside?
Generators should never be used indoors due to the risk of carbon monoxide poisoning. Sufficient ventilation is critically important, so they must be operated outdoors in well-ventilated areas to maintain safe conditions and eliminate the risk of toxic gas buildup.

What Are the Best Practices for Storing My Generator Safely?
To safely store a generator, make sure it is clean and dry, remove fuel to prevent degradation, cover it with a protective tarp, and keep it in a well-ventilated, dry area away from flammable materials.
